VOLUNTARY ACTIONSINVOLUNTARY ACTIONS 15. example … WebA well-studied example of a fixed action pattern occurs in ground-nesting water birds, like greylag geese. If a female greylag goose's egg rolls out of her nest, she will instinctively use her bill to push the egg back into the nest in a series of very stereotyped, predictable, movements. The sight of an egg outside the nest is the stimulus ... Webaccounts of voluntary and involuntary actions. In EE, Aristotle identifies the class of actions which are voluntary with the class of actions for which the agent is morally responsible. We can see this from 1228a10-11 where Aristotle makes four claims: (1) Involuntary bad acts are not blamed (2) Involuntary good acts are not praised
